Abstract
In a bus resource having an outbound pipe for processing both non-posted and posted transactions in a FIFO manner, a rejected non-posted transaction at the head of the outbound pipe is moved aside and into an auxiliary buffer to avoid a potential blockage of the outbound pipe. The auxiliary buffer is for holding transaction information and return data of the rejected non-posted transaction. The rejected transaction is eventually completed from the auxiliary buffer as determined by an arbiter.
